3DS Predicted to Beat DS First-Year Sales

Nintendo announced today that since its release in March, the Nintendo 3DS has sold 1.65 million units in the United States. The company also noted that the original Nintendo DS managed to sell 2.37 million units in its first two months, and half of those sales came from the holiday season. If the 3DS follows the same trend, the new handheld will outsell the original in terms of first-year sales.

“With a massive lineup of software on the way and the first-year sales record of Nintendo DS in its sights, Nintendo 3DS enters its first holiday season with a full head of steam,” said Scott Moffitt, Nintendo of America’s executive vice president of Sales & Marketing.

More sales information will be available when the full set of NPD sales numbers are revealed.
